In a chemical battery, the direct conversion of Chemical energy into electrical energy is the result of spontaneous chemical reactions such as oxidation and reduction in the battery, which are carried out on two electrodes respectively. The negative electrode active material is composed of reducing agents with negative potential and stable in the electrolyte, such as active metals such as zinc, cadmium, lead, and hydrogen or hydrocarbons. The positive active material is composed of oxidants with positive potential and stable in electrolyte, such as Manganese dioxide, Lead dioxide, nickel oxide and other metal oxides, oxygen or air, halogen and its salts, Oxyacid and its salts, etc. Electrolytes are materials with good ionic conductivity, such as aqueous solutions of acids, bases, and salts, organic or inorganic non-aqueous solutions, molten salts, or solid electrolytes. When the external circuit is disconnected, although there is a potential difference (open circuit voltage) between the two poles, there is no current, and the Chemical energy stored in the battery is not converted into electrical energy. When the external circuit is closed, current flows through the external circuit under the action of the potential difference between the two electrodes. At the same time, within the battery, due to the absence of free electrons in the electrolyte, the transfer of charge is inevitably accompanied by the oxidation or reduction reaction between the polar active substance and the electrolyte interface, as well as the migration of reactants and reaction products. The transfer of charge in the electrolyte is also completed by the migration of ions. Therefore, the normal charge transfer and material transfer process inside the battery is a necessary condition to ensure the normal output of electrical energy. When charging, the direction of power and mass transfer inside the battery is exactly opposite to that of discharge; The electrode reaction must be reversible in order to ensure the normal process of mass and electricity transfer in the opposite direction. Therefore, reversible electrode reactions are a necessary condition for forming a battery. In fact, when the current flows through the electrode, the electrode potential will deviate from the electrode potential of Thermodynamic equilibrium. This phenomenon is called polarization. The greater the current density (the current passing through the unit electrode area), the more severe the polarization. Polarization phenomenon is one of the important reasons for energy loss in batteries.
